Diagnostic Workup for Postprandial Vomiting
The diagnostic workup for postprandial vomiting should begin with a thorough assessment for mechanical obstruction, gastroparesis, and functional disorders, as these represent the most common causes requiring specific interventions. 1
Initial Assessment
- Obtain detailed history focusing on timing of vomiting in relation to meals, character of vomitus (bilious, bloody, undigested food), associated symptoms, and duration of symptoms 1
- Evaluate for risk factors including diabetes, recent surgery, medication use (especially opioids, anticholinergics), and cannabis use 1
- Physical examination should focus on hydration status, abdominal tenderness, and presence of distension to identify potential complications 1
- Differentiate vomiting from regurgitation, rumination, and bulimia to ensure accurate diagnosis 1
Basic Laboratory Testing
- Complete blood count, serum electrolytes, glucose, liver function tests, and lipase to rule out metabolic causes and assess for complications (diagnostic yield 70-80%) 1
- Urinalysis to evaluate hydration status and rule out renal causes (sensitivity 90%, specificity 80%) 1
- For persistent vomiting >2-3 weeks, evaluate thiamin levels to prevent neurological complications 1
First-Line Diagnostic Tests
- Upper endoscopy (esophagogastroduodenoscopy) is essential to rule out mechanical obstruction before diagnosing a functional or motility disorder (diagnostic accuracy 95%) 1, 2
- Gastric emptying scintigraphy is the gold standard test for diagnosing gastroparesis (sensitivity 90%, specificity 80%) 1, 2
- The scintigraphy should be performed for at least 2 hours after ingestion of a radiolabeled meal, with 4-hour testing providing higher diagnostic yield and accuracy 1, 2
Proper Gastric Emptying Scintigraphy Technique
- The radioisotope must be cooked into the solid portion of the meal for accurate results 2
- A standardized low-fat, egg white meal labeled with 99mTc sulfur colloid consumed with jam and toast as a sandwich is recommended 2
- Medications that influence gastric emptying should be withdrawn for 48-72 hours prior to testing 2
- Blood glucose should be monitored and maintained within normal range during the test, as hyperglycemia itself can slow gastric emptying 2
Alternative Diagnostic Methods
- Breath testing using non-radioactive substances correlates well with scintigraphy and can be used as an alternative when scintigraphy is unavailable 2
- Antroduodenal manometry provides information about coordination of gastric and duodenal motor function and may help differentiate between neuropathic or myopathic motility disorders 2
Common Pitfalls to Avoid
- Relying solely on symptoms for diagnosis is inadequate as symptoms correlate poorly with the degree of gastric emptying delay 2
- Failure to control blood glucose during testing can lead to false positive results 2
- Not accounting for medications that can affect gastric emptying (prokinetics, opioids, anticholinergics) can lead to inaccurate results 2
Management Considerations
- Ensure adequate hydration with oral or intravenous fluids as needed to prevent dehydration and electrolyte imbalances 1
- Consider antiemetic therapy such as ondansetron for symptom control while completing diagnostic evaluation 1, 3
- For suspected gastroparesis, dietary modifications including smaller, more frequent meals with lower fat and fiber content may provide symptomatic relief 1, 4
- Evaluate and consider discontinuing medications that may cause or exacerbate vomiting 1
